What Is A Chore Chart?

You’ve probably experienced the daily struggle for chores when you have kids. Children don’t like doing chores, and you feel that it’s your obligation to make sure that they get done. What if chore time could be enjoyable for all? Enter the chore chart.

A chore chart is an illustration of the tasks to be accomplished around the house. Each family member gets the column and has to keep track of the tasks they have completed.

Not only can a chore chart assist in keeping everyone on track and on track, it also lets you to determine in a glance which people are slowing in their chores. If everyone is working together to keep the home neat, it’s incredible how much easier it is for everyone involved!

How Do You Make An Printable Chore Sheet?

It can help you keep your family organized through the creation of a chore chart. This is how you can make the printable list of chores everyone can use.

Start by making a list with all the tasks within the home. Once you’ve made your list, decide who will be responsible for each task. It could be feasible to assign duties based on age and ability.

Next, make a printable checklist of each task and who’s responsible. You should leave plenty of space to allow people to tick off the tasks they have completed. You might also wish to include specific days of the week , or time frames when certain tasks must to be completed.

Make sure you put up your chore charts where so that everyone is able to view it.

How To Utilize The Chore Sheet

A chore chart can be a helpful tool for getting children to participate in the home. Here are some ways to utilize a list of chores:

  1. Be simple. Include a few chores for children of a certain age on the list.
  2. Your child can help you create the chart with you. This will make them more likely to believe in it.
  3. Recognize tasks accomplished by rewarding them with stickers or points regularly.
  4. This chart is a great tool to instill accountability and good work habits.
  5. Finally, don’t forget to praise your child when they are doing a great job!
